Kadhak (ཀ་དག།) means ‘primordially pure’ in Tibetan language. It describes the state of basic goodness which is true to all beings. As the name implies, Kadhak is dedicated to work towards creating a better world in our small way to make a lasting impact.

Kadhak is a socially conscious enterprise. Founded in 2018 to address limited opportunities for Tibetan women on the plateau. Without safe and sustainable opportunities for economic and life choices, women remain subjected to the outdated norms that define what they can and cannot do. At the same time Kadhak deeply value the harmonious, communal and nature-based way of life of our nomadic community and preserve these practices while sharing our traditional holistic culture.

Through engaging primarily women with near-home income opportunities and skill trainings that will enhance their economic independence and sometimes self-worth, Kadhak creates a range of locally sourced sustainable organic products while focusing on building awareness, cultural confidence and creative income opportunities that support cultural and environmental conservation while embracing positive change.

Yak Butter Handmade Soap

Our products are handmade with love and care using the most natural local ingredients like organic yak butter, organic yak milk, raw honey and herbs that are hand harvested in the wild. Even down to 90% of our packaging are compostable and biodegradable. Since the handmade soaps we make, have natural and organic ingredients in the soaps, it is good for the skin and the environment. Most commercial soaps available in the market today contain harsh chemicals such as sodium laureth sulfate and sodium lauryl sulfate. They strip the natural oils and moisture off your skin, leaving them dry and prone to irritation. These chemicals pollute the water resources they end up. Hence, destroying the environment.

Natural ingredients in these handmade soaps like yak butter, raw honey, sea buckthorn essential oils are great for skin for their known properties. They are better for the environment because they are natural.
